[00:01:43] Nudge | The "Work Harder" Myth
The belief that working harder leads to recognition has normalized 60-hour work weeks, but if this guaranteed success, every exhausted leader would be thriving at executive level. Working harder only addresses the external world while ignoring your inner and outer worlds, actually depleting the neurochemicals your brain needs for clear thinking.

[00:09:39] Case Study | The Three-Year Plateau
Jay remained stuck for four years despite being first in, last out and meticulously prepared, describing leadership as "pushing a boulder uphill while others pushed back." By reconstructing her communication approach rather than working harder, she transformed from invisible to securing a permanent senior leadership position within a year.
